What is an Abdominal X-ray?
An abdominal X-ray is a fast, non-invasive diagnostic imaging test used to examine the organs and structures inside your abdomen, including the stomach, intestines, liver, kidneys, and bladder. This common medical test helps detect a wide range of abdominal problems and is often one of the first imaging tools used to assess unexplained symptoms.

What Does an Abdominal X-Ray Detect?

Kidney Stones
Identifies stones in the kidney or urinary tract

Digestive Blockages
Detects intestinal obstructions

Abnormal Gas or Fluids
diagnose perforations in the intestines

Swallowed Objects
Useful for detecting foreign objects in children

Organ Enlargement
Detects abnormalities in liver, spleen, or kidneys
How to Prepare for an Abdominal X-Ray?
Wear Loose, Comfortable Clothes – Avoid metal buttons or zippers
Fasting May Be Required – In some cases, doctors may ask for fasting
Remove Jewelry& Metal Accessories – To avoid interference
Inform Your Doctor – If pregnant or having any medical implants

Feature | Abdominal X-Ray | Ultrasound | CT Scan |
Purpose | Detects kidney stones, blockages & gas buildup | Examines soft tissues & pregnancy-related concerns | Detailed imaging of internal organs |
Radiation Exposure | Low | None | Higher |
Speed | Very fast (5-10 min) | Moderate (20-30 min) | Longer (30-60 min) |
Cost | Affordable | Affordable | Expensive |
